The Year's Best Horror Stories: Series VIII
Overview
For the reader who hasn't the patience to search through several shelves of books and magazines for enough good horror stories to furnish a year's worth of nightmares—don't despair, those untroubled nights are over. Collected here are the best horror stories to be published in 1979. Here you will find both traditional and non-traditional horrors, terrors from the supernatural and from the inner mind. Some of these stories are from the most noted authors of the fantasy genre, others represent only an author's first or second published story.
All of these stories do have one point in common, however, and that is their power to create a convincing mood of fear and unease. In selecting these stories this series' new editor, the well-known writer of fantastic adventure, Karl Edward Wagner, followed no restrictive definitions, guidelines or taboos. The goal was to gather together the best...
WELCOME TO THEIR NIGHTMARES...
Contents:
Introduction: Access to Horror by Karl Edward Wagner.
The Dead Line by Dennis Etchison.
To Wake the Dead by Ramsey Campbell.
In the Fourth Year of the War by Harlan Ellison.
From the Lower Deep by Hugh B. Cave.
The Baby-Sitter by Davis Grubb.
The Well at the Half Cat by John C. Tibbetts.
My Beautiful Darkling by Eddy C. Bertin.
A Serious Call by George Hay.
Sheets by Alan Ryan.
Billy Wolfe's Riding Spirit by Kevin A. Lyons.
Lex Talionis by Russell Kirk.
Entombed by Robert Keefe.
A Fly One by Steve Sneyd.
Needle Song by Charles L. Grant.
All the Birds Come Home to Roost by Harlan Ellison.
The Devil Behind You by Richard A. Moore.
